Man Arrested for Walking Bare-Legged Near Bupyeong Station Tests Positive for Drugs
Incheon Bupyeong Police Station announced today (the 18th) that they have apprehended and are investigating a man in his 50s, identified as A, on charges of violating the Narcotics Control Act and public indecency after he roamed the streets without pants while under the influence of drugs.

A is suspected of walking around near Bupyeong Station on Gyeongin National Railway (Seoul Subway Line 1) in Bupyeong-gu, Incheon, at around 9:53 a.m. the previous day without wearing any pants while under the influence of philopon (methamphetamine).

A was arrested at the scene as a flagrant offender by police dispatched to the location, and a preliminary drug screening test confirmed a positive reaction for narcotics.

A police official stated, "We plan to request a detailed analysis from the National Forensic Service," adding, "We are investigating the specific circumstances of the incident, including how he obtained the drugs."
